An Adaptive Modulation in Millimeter-Wave Communication System for Tropical Region
Abstract: The dominant
propagation factor affecting the outage and the spectral efficiency of
millimeter-wave communication systems operating at frequencies 30 GHz is rain
attenuation. An adaptive modulation is proposed to improve the outage and
spectral efficiency performance of the system. This paper presents an
analytical procedure for the evaluation of the outage and spectral efficiency
of the system in Indonesia with heavy rain rate. By comparing analytic and
simulation a validation was conducted. The results show that adaptive
modulation can significantly improve the outage and the spectral efficiency
performance of the system, for links with long distance.
